F-tests
F-tests are a class of statistical tests that compare the variances between groups to ascertain whether the means are significantly different, often based on F distribution.
One-tailed Tests
A type of hypothesis test that determines if there is a significant difference in a specific direction between the compared groups.
Population Variances
A measure of the dispersion of a population's values, quantifying how much the members of the population differ from the population mean.
